Staggered release of ChatGPT 5.6 follows similar restrictions on rival firm Anthropic’s latest AI models
OpenAI released its latest advanced AI model, called ChatGPT 5.6, on Thursday after earlier delaying the public rollout over US government concerns about cybersecurity. The Trump administration had requested last month that OpenAI limit the release to a small group of government-approved users.
OpenAI complied with the White House’s request last month. The company stated in a blogpost that it had briefed government officials on ChatGPT 5.6’s capabilities and restricted the model to trusted partners at their behest. The product’s wider release came after additional testing by the government’s Center for AI Standards and Innovation agency, according to Axios.

Topline The White House—which briefly grounded the new Air Force One gifted by Qatar—assured Forbes the plane was safe from the “many enemies of America who have their sights on” Trump, but questions have emerged over whether it has met the necessary security upgrades. Some experts have questioned whether the new, Qatari-gifted Air Force One has all the proper security protocols. (Photo by SAUL LOEB / AFP via Getty Images) AFP via Getty Images Key Facts Steven Cheung, White House communications director, told Forbes the jet gifted to Trump by Qatar last year has been “fitted with high-level security protocols that ensure the safety of the President and his staff,” saying there are “many enemies of America who have their sights on him,” though he did not elaborate on specific costs or upgrades.
